About the Role
We are looking for a Manager Network Platforms Operations who can provide operational leadership across Rio Tinto’s Enterprise and Operational Technology (OT) network throughout the Asia Pacific region. This is a great opportunity for an experienced and collaborative network operations and people leader to influence the performance, reliability and security of critical infrastructure services across our global organisation.
Based in Perth, you will lead a highly capable team and partner network, while driving operational excellence, service performance and continuous improvement across our complex technology landscape.
Reporting to the Senior Manager of Network Platforms and working within the global Infrastructure and Operations team, you will:
- Lead the operational delivery of Enterprise and OT network services across the APAC region, ensuring safe, secure and reliable performance
- Manage strategic delivery partners and vendors, including ensuring performance against agreed SLAs, KPIs and contractual obligations
- Build and maintain strong stakeholder relationships across operations, technology teams, business leaders and external service providers
- Drive operational excellence through standardisation, automation and continuous improvement initiatives, ensuring network services meet security, compliance and governance requirements while supporting broader IS&T objectives
- Lead, coach and develop a high-performing team capable of effectively managing complex network environments and partner relationships
- Collaborate with and support global and regional Network Platform teams to deliver consistent positive outcomes and customer experiences
About You
To be successful in this role, you must be able to demonstrate:
- A commitment to the safety of yourself and your team
- Extensive experience leading large-scale Enterprise and/or Operational Technology network operations within complex, multinational or global organisations
- Proven experience managing critical 24/7 operational services and driving service performance against SLAs and KPIs
- Strong vendor and partner management experience, with the ability to influence outcomes across multiple stakeholder groups
- Technical expertise across enterprise networking, data centre environments, LTE/5G technologies and modern network operations practices
- Leadership experience including developing high-performing teams, coupled with strong communication and stakeholder engagement skills

About Rio Tinto
Rio Tinto is a leading global mining and materials company. We operate in 35 countries where we produce iron ore, copper, aluminium, critical minerals, and other materials needed for the global energy transition and for people, communities, and nations to thrive.
We have been mining for 150 years and operate with knowledge built up across generations and continents. Our purpose is finding better ways to provide the materials the world needs – striving for innovation and continuous improvement to produce materials with low emissions and to the right environmental, social and governance standards.
